Since the Target deals are usually of the "your mileage may vary" type, let's keep all the target clearance deals in this thread.

Here is a fairly easy way to check if your local Target has the games on clearance without making the store clerk unlock the display case and price-scan a bunch of games. Very often, games may be on sale, but will not be marked as such.

BigDirty came up with this nice time saver. Respect his cheap ass skills.

1) Check this thread for games that have been reported on clearance.

2) Go to www.half.com, http://bits.com/ or similar website and search for the game to locate its UPC code number. Its in the grey box underneath the box art graphic.

3) Go to http://upcdata.info/ , www.milk.com/barcode/ , or www.upcdatabase.com and enter the code so you can print out the UPC.

4) Go to Target and use the price scanners to scan your printouts and search for cheap ass deals!

FYI: "When a game's price ends with 8 cents, further reduction is possible, when it ends in 4 cents, that's the ball game, pick it up cause it's not going any lower. If it ends in 9 cents, it's just on sale or on a non-clearance reduction." - BigDirty

Games that do not sell after being discounted are often donated to local Goodwills for sale at their retail stores, so check there when the clearance items dissappear.

Target's clearance tagging is a wierd process. I know there have been several long winded write ups online and you still walk away not knowing the answers. I know locally electronics clearance take place on mondays however regular targets seem to clearance the items before super targets around here. On top of that certain stores seem to clearance weeks earlier possibly based on volume. When the PSP game clearance hit last year I found I sort of learned the pattern locally here in the atl surburbs. I would expect its worth learning the pattern in your area with the upcoming mass markdowns expected in the fall leading up to the Wii/ps3 markdowns...
